J. Revuz is a scholar working on Dermatology, Pharmacology and Pathology and Forensic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, J. Revuz has authored 156 papers receiving a total of 7.9k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 76 papers in Dermatology, 42 papers in Pharmacology and 30 papers in Pathology and Forensic Medicine. Recurrent topics in J. Revuz's work include Drug-Induced Adverse Reactions (40 papers), Autoimmune Bullous Skin Diseases (22 papers) and Hidradenitis Suppurativa and Treatments (21 papers). J. Revuz is often cited by papers focused on Drug-Induced Adverse Reactions (40 papers), Autoimmune Bullous Skin Diseases (22 papers) and Hidradenitis Suppurativa and Treatments (21 papers). J. Revuz collaborates with scholars based in France, United States and Switzerland. J. Revuz's co-authors include P. Wolkenstein, Sylvie Bastuji‐Garin, Jean‐Claude Roujeau, F. Poli, Jean‐Claude Roujeau, Nathalie Fouchard, M. Bertocchi, Gregor B. E. Jemec, G. Gabison and F. Pouget and has published in prestigious journals such as The Lancet, CHEST Journal and Journal of Investigative Dermatology.
